Exploring the Key Aspects of 3M's Dividend Policy:
1. Dividend Payment Schedule:
3M typically pays dividends on a quarterly basis. This means investors who own 3M stock receive a dividend payment four times a year. The exact payment dates vary slightly each year, but they generally follow a consistent pattern. These dates are usually announced in advance by 3M, allowing investors to plan accordingly. To find the precise payment dates, one should consult 3M's official investor relations website.

3. Factors Influencing Dividend Decisions:
Several factors influence 3M's decision to declare and pay dividends. These include:
- Company Profitability: 3M's profitability is the most significant factor. High earnings allow for larger dividend payouts. Low or declining profitability may lead to dividend reductions or suspensions.
- Cash Flow: Consistent positive cash flow is essential for sustaining dividend payments. A company’s ability to generate sufficient cash to cover dividends without harming its operations is a key consideration.
- Debt Levels: High levels of debt can constrain a company's ability to pay dividends. 3M needs to balance dividend payments with its debt obligations.
- Investment Opportunities: If 3M identifies significant investment opportunities for growth, it might prioritize reinvesting profits instead of increasing dividends. This reflects a trade-off between short-term payouts and long-term growth.
- Industry Conditions: Broader economic conditions and competitive pressures within the industry also impact dividend decisions.
4. Accessing Current Information:
The most reliable source for current information on 3M's dividend is the company's official investor relations website. This website provides press releases announcing dividend declarations, including the payment date, record date (the date by which you must own the stock to receive the dividend), and the dividend amount per share.

Further Analysis: Examining Dividend Payout Ratio in Greater Detail:
The dividend payout ratio, which is the percentage of earnings paid out as dividends, provides further insight into 3M's dividend policy. A high payout ratio suggests a greater commitment to returning profits to shareholders, but it could also indicate less reinvestment in growth opportunities. A lower payout ratio suggests more emphasis on reinvestment in future growth. Analyzing 3M's historical payout ratios alongside its earnings and free cash flow provides a more comprehensive understanding of its financial health and dividend sustainability.
FAQ Section: Answering Common Questions About 3M's Dividend:
Q: How can I find the exact dates of 3M's upcoming dividend payments?
A: The most reliable source is 3M's official investor relations website. Look for press releases or announcements regarding dividend declarations.
Q: What happens if I buy 3M stock just before the ex-dividend date?
A: The ex-dividend date is the date on which the stock begins trading without the dividend. If you purchase the stock on or after the ex-dividend date, you will not receive the upcoming dividend.
Q: What is 3M's dividend yield?
A: The dividend yield is the annual dividend per share divided by the current stock price. This fluctuates with the stock price. You can find the current dividend yield on major financial websites.
Q: Is 3M's dividend sustainable in the long term?
A: The sustainability of 3M's dividend depends on its future financial performance. While the historical record is positive, investors should monitor the company's financial health and industry trends to assess the long-term outlook.
